适用于macOS的MySQL Cluster 8.0.27版本发布

版权申诉
0 下载量 106 浏览量 更新于2024-11-18 收藏 257.72MB GZ 举报
资源摘要信息:"MySQL Cluster 8.0.27是MySQL数据库管理系统的一个分布式高性能版本,专门设计用于提供高可用性、可扩展性和容错性。它支持在不同的物理或虚拟服务器上运行数据节点和管理节点,以实现跨多个服务器的数据冗余和故障转移,从而确保关键业务应用的连续性。MySQL Cluster 8.0.27版本特别支持macOS 11(Big Sur)操作系统,适用于x86架构的64位处理器。通过提供的压缩文件/mysql-cluster-8.0.27-macos11-x86_64.tar.gz,用户可以轻松地在Mac平台上安装和配置MySQL Cluster。 在了解MySQL Cluster 8.0.27之前,我们需要明确几个核心概念: - 高可用性(High Availability):指系统能够在没有单点故障的情况下提供服务的能力,即使在部分节点发生故障时,系统也能继续运行。 - 可扩展性(Scalability):系统能够通过增加资源来应对负载增加的能力,MySQL Cluster通过添加更多节点来水平扩展数据存储和处理能力。 - 容错性(Fault Tolerance):系统即使在部分组件故障的情况下,也能够继续运行不中断服务的能力。 MySQL Cluster 8.0.27的核心组件包括: - 数据节点(Data Nodes):存储数据并提供数据的读写服务,支持多个数据节点的分布,实现数据的冗余。 - 管理节点(Management Nodes):负责监控和管理整个集群的状态,如节点的添加、删除和故障恢复等。 - SQL节点(SQL Nodes):也称为API节点,它为应用程序提供标准SQL接口,通过执行SQL语句来与数据节点交互。 此外,MySQL Cluster使用NDB Cluster存储引擎,允许在同一个集群内同时处理在线事务处理(OLTP)和在线分析处理(OLAP),这样可以提供更全面的数据处理能力。 在安装和配置MySQL Cluster 8.0.27时,用户需要进行以下步骤: 1. 确认系统要求,确保运行环境符合macOS 11的64位架构。 2. 下载压缩包/mysql-cluster-8.0.27-macos11-x86_64.tar.gz。 3. 解压缩文件到指定目录。 4. 根据MySQL Cluster的官方文档进行安装和初始化配置。 5. 配置管理节点,以监控集群状态和执行管理任务。 6. 启动数据节点和服务节点,并进行必要的网络配置。 7. 运行测试以验证集群的高可用性和性能。 需要注意的是,安装MySQL Cluster之前,建议阅读官方的安装指南和最佳实践文档,以确保对安装过程中的各种选项和参数有充分的理解。同时,对于生产环境的部署,用户应该进行彻底的测试以确保系统的稳定性和可靠性。 除了上述提到的特性,MySQL Cluster 8.0.27还支持许多高级特性,例如: - 数据的实时备份和恢复。 - 支持通过NoSQL API访问数据,为开发者提供了更多灵活性。 - 支持异步复制,允许数据在不同地理位置的多个集群之间进行复制。 MySQL Cluster 8.0.27的发布也伴随着对性能的优化,提高了数据的处理能力和响应速度。这一版本的更新还包括对安全特性的增强,比如改进了身份验证和加密连接的机制。 对于那些寻求在macOS平台上部署高性能、高可用性数据库解决方案的开发者和IT专业人士来说,MySQL Cluster 8.0.27提供了一个强大的选择。它可以帮助用户构建健壮的应用程序,减少由于硬件故障或系统问题导致的服务中断时间,从而提升整体的用户体验和业务效率。"